summaryrefslogtreecommitdiff
Commit message (Expand)AuthorAgeFilesLines
* Add FIXME marks.gniibe-curve25519NIIBE Yutaka2014-07-044-2/+13
* fix mpi_swap_conditional and update mpi_ec_mul_point.NIIBE Yutaka2014-07-042-54/+46
* Don't support special x-only format by os2ec.NIIBE Yutaka2014-07-041-6/+1
* This works.NIIBE Yutaka2014-07-042-1/+6
* scalar handling.NIIBE Yutaka2014-07-042-3/+15
* simplifyNIIBE Yutaka2014-07-041-17/+6
* use mpi_swap_conditionalNIIBE Yutaka2014-07-041-59/+36
* mpi_swap_conditionalNIIBE Yutaka2014-07-049-1/+58
* Handle O in _gcry_mpi_ec_mul_point for MPI_EC_MONTGOMERY.NIIBE Yutaka2014-07-042-6/+62
* for macosNIIBE Yutaka2014-07-041-0/+6
* more montgomeryNIIBE Yutaka2014-07-046-35/+163
* support ec_get_affineNIIBE Yutaka2014-07-042-61/+70
* Add Curve25519NIIBE Yutaka2014-07-043-2/+153
* Speed-up SHA-1 NEON assembly implementationJussi Kivilinna2014-06-291-73/+82
* gostr3411_94: rewrite to use u32 mathematicDmitry Eremin-Solenikov2014-06-283-103/+139
* gost28147: use bufhelp helpersDmitry Eremin-Solenikov2014-06-281-36/+10
* Fixup curve name in the GOST2012 test caseDmitry Eremin-Solenikov2014-06-281-1/+1
* Update PBKDF2 tests with GOST R 34.11-94 test casesDmitry Eremin-Solenikov2014-06-281-3/+67
* Add GOST R 34.11-94 variant using id-GostR3411-94-CryptoProParamSetDmitry Eremin-Solenikov2014-06-287-9/+35
* gost28147: support GCRYCTL_SET_SBOXDmitry Eremin-Solenikov2014-06-281-0/+39
* Support setting s-box for the ciphers that require itDmitry Eremin-Solenikov2014-06-283-1/+14
* cipher/gost28147: generate optimized s-boxes from compact onesDmitry Eremin-Solenikov2014-06-285-274/+272
* gost28147: add OIDs used to define cipher modeDmitry Eremin-Solenikov2014-06-281-1/+11
* GOST R 34.11-94 add OIDsDmitry Eremin-Solenikov2014-06-281-1/+14
* tests: add larger test-vectors for hash algorithmsJussi Kivilinna2014-05-211-0/+111
* sha512: fix ARM/NEON implementationJussi Kivilinna2014-05-212-1/+14
* Fix ARM assembly when building __PIC__Jussi Kivilinna2014-05-204-10/+64
* Add Poly1305 to documentationJussi Kivilinna2014-05-171-6/+36
* chacha20: add SSE2/AMD64 optimized implementationJussi Kivilinna2014-05-164-1/+672
* poly1305: add AMD64/AVX2 optimized implementationJussi Kivilinna2014-05-165-4/+1002
* poly1305: add AMD64/SSE2 optimized implementationJussi Kivilinna2014-05-125-3/+1091
* Add Poly1305 based cipher AEAD modeJussi Kivilinna2014-05-127-30/+805
* Add Poly1305-AES (-Camellia, etc) MACsJussi Kivilinna2014-05-127-15/+244
* Add Poly1305 MACJussi Kivilinna2014-05-1210-11/+1210
* chacha20/AVX2: clear upper-halfs of YMM registers on entryJussi Kivilinna2014-05-121-0/+1
* chacha20/AVX2: check for ENABLE_AVX2_SUPPORT instead of HAVE_GCC_INLINE_ASM_AVX2Jussi Kivilinna2014-05-122-2/+2
* chacha20/SSSE3: clear XMM registers after useJussi Kivilinna2014-05-121-0/+16
* chacha20: add AVX2/AMD64 assembly implementationJussi Kivilinna2014-05-114-2/+970
* chacha20: add SSSE3 assembly implementationJussi Kivilinna2014-05-114-1/+640
* Add ChaCha20 stream cipherJussi Kivilinna2014-05-118-7/+853
* mpi: Fix a subtle bug setting spurious bits with in mpi_set_bit.Werner Koch2014-05-092-2/+60
* Comment typo fixWerner Koch2014-05-091-1/+1
* Bump LT version.Werner Koch2014-05-071-2/+3
* random: Small patch for consistency and really burn the stack.Werner Koch2014-04-221-7/+9
* pubkey: Re-map all depreccated RSA algo numbers.Werner Koch2014-04-161-8/+6
* cipher: Fix possible NULL dereference.Werner Koch2014-04-152-5/+2
* 3des: add amd64 assembly implementation for 3DESJussi Kivilinna2014-03-307-7/+1362
* tests: Print diagnostics for skipped tests.Werner Koch2014-03-131-4/+92
* Add MD2 message digest implementationDmitry Eremin-Solenikov2014-03-115-1/+201
* Add an utility to calculate hashes over a set of filesDmitry Eremin-Solenikov2014-03-043-1/+123